Transaction 57a81f9245602affd90e7e27ae4f6ac24193830fe6a43aade7775d89566d71aa
1 Input
1 Output
-
57a81f9245602affd90e7e27ae4f6ac24193830fe6a43aade7775d89566d71aa:0
- value
- 2291391
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ce9ae9d15afe868b2f6cdc515420e1666eb1d54
- address
- bc1qtn56a8g44l5x3vhkehz32sswzenwk825588dpd